A quart of milk contains a mean of 35 g of butterfat, with a standard deviation of 4 g. If the butterfat is normally distributed, find the probability that a quart of this brand of milk chosen at random will contain the following. (Round your answers to four decimal places.)

(a) between 35 and 39 g of butterfat


(b) between 25 and 35 g of butterfat

The heights of a certain species of plant are normally distributed, with mean μ = 23 cm and standard deviation σ = 4 cm. What is the probability that a plant chosen at random will be between 17 and 29 cm tall? (Round your answer to four decimal places.)

Suppose a population of scores x is normally distributed with μ = 60 and σ = 10. Use the standard normal distribution to find the probability indicated. (Round your answer to four decimal places.)

Pr(55 ≤ x ≤ 65)
